Seongbuk-gu 'Disabled Family Support Center' Opens


[Asia Economy Reporter Park Jong-il] Seongbuk-gu (Mayor Lee Seung-ro) has opened the 'Disabled Family Support Center' for the happiness of both people with disabilities and their families.


The 'Disabled Family Support Center,' opened on the 11th in Jongam-dong (129 Jongam-ro, Room 305), will encompass the local community and connect various services to alleviate the social and psychological burdens experienced by families of people with disabilities.


A Seongbuk-gu official stated, “We have opened a hub center that designs and connects various supports for families of people with disabilities, aiming to be a city where both people with disabilities and their families are happy, and where the rights of people with disabilities are properly realized.”


The Disabled Family Support Center links specialized community services to expand leisure and cultural programs for families of people with disabilities. It also operates programs that share the difficulties of families, such as providing emergency care services for people with disabilities when caregivers are absent.


The Seongbuk-gu Disabled Persons' Organizations Federation, selected through a public contest, will be entrusted with operation for three years.


Mayor Lee Seung-ro expressed, “The region will join hands to reduce the social and psychological burdens of families of people with disabilities and provide a cooperative link among these families, striving to make Seongbuk-gu a happy community for all members.”
